Sporting News' Top 100: No. 23 North Carolina


Linebacker 's 40-yard dash this spring was so fast the North Carolina strength coaches made him do it again. Surely, they thought, the timer made a mistake. Brown had been timed at 4.28 seconds in the 40. As it turned out, there was no mistake. The second time, with four strength coaches timing him, he ran it in 4.26 seconds. His teammates erupted in excitement after the time was announced. (Sporting News)
